It's important to understand how killers like Bundy operate. All of their lives they have 'dual' lives in a way. The one that nobody sees until its too late, and the one they show to the world. The one that enables them to walk among the masses, their true self hidden. They need this cover. Without it they would not be able to do what they do, which is kill. Nobody in their right mind would have gone with Bundy if he showed his true face, hence the mask.

By the time of Bundy's trial for the Leach murder he already was facing 2 death sentenses. The pressure was on, his secrects were being revealed, and he was begining to unravel mentally. This is very common with serial killers. If you study his crimes, you can tell he was falling apart quickly during the Florida murders. He knew it was just a matter of time.

At that last trial, that was the Bundy that really was, no mask, no charm, his handsome face contorted in rage. That is the face that all his victims saw as they were dying. Think about that.

How was forensic evidence used to prove Ted Bundy's guilt?

In the days prior to DNA and fiber analysis, forensics as we now know them were much less of a science than they are today. The proverbial nails in the coffin for Bundy was the bite mark evidence, a novel idea at the time. Much of Bundy's case was still considered circumstantial. Be that as it may, the juries had no trouble finding Bundy guilty of multiple counts of murder.

Were there any legal precedents set by the Ted Bundy case?

I believe that Bundy's trial was the first to introduce a dental expert to match the bite mark on a victim's body to Bundy's teeth. It has since been suggested that this method is not as accurate as first thought.
